8.6 Página de Issues de um Repositório no GitHub: Aba Issues

A página principal de Issues no GitHub lista todas as issues de um repositório, permitindo que você visualize, busque e filtre as tarefas registradas. Aqui, abordaremos os elementos essenciais para que você possa navegar e utilizar essa ferramenta de maneira simples e eficiente.

Barra de Busca

A barra de busca permite procurar por issues específicas dentro do repositório. Você pode digitar palavras-chave para encontrar rapidamente algo relevante.

Exemplo de uso: Digite "saudação" para encontrar todas as issues que mencionam essa palavra.

Se quiser usar filtros mais avançados na busca, consulte a documentação oficial do GitHub.

Barra de busca

Botão "Labels"

O botão "Labels", localizado logo ao lado da barra de busca, leva à página de gerenciamento de labels do repositório (8.5.1 Gerenciando Labels de um Repositório no GitHub). Lá, é possível criar, editar e excluir labels utilizadas para categorizar as issues.

Botão Labels

Botão "New Issue"

O botão "New Issue" permite criar uma nova issue no repositório. Utilize-o para relatar problemas, sugerir melhorias ou registrar tarefas pendentes (8.2 Criando uma Issue no GitHub).

Botão New issue

Cabeçalho da Lista de Issues

Cabeçalho da Lista de Issues

Checkbox para Selecionar ou Desselecionar Tudo

No cabeçalho da lista de issues, há um checkbox que permite selecionar ou desmarcar todas as issues visíveis na página. Isso facilita a aplicação de ações em lote, como fechar múltiplas issues de uma vez.

Filtros

Logo abaixo da barra de busca, há filtros prontos que ajudam a visualizar as issues de acordo com seu status:

  • Open (Abertas): Exibe apenas issues que ainda estão pendentes ou em discussão.

  • Closed (Fechadas): Exibe apenas issues que já foram resolvidas ou descartadas.

  • Author (Pessoa Autora): Filtra as issues criadas por uma pessoa específica.

  • Labels (Etiquetas): Permite visualizar issues associadas a determinadas etiquetas. Basta clicar no filtro "Labels" e selecionar uma ou mais etiquetas para encontrar issues categorizadas de maneira específica.

  • Assignees (Pessoas Atribuídas): Filtra as issues atribuídas a uma pessoa colaboradora específica.

Ordenação das Issues

Por padrão, as issues são exibidas das mais recentes para as mais antigas. Você pode mudar essa ordenação clicando no botão "Newest" e escolhendo outras opções:

Botão de ordenação das issues
  • Created on (Criadas em): Ordena as issues pela data de criação.

  • Last updated (Última atualização): Ordena as issues com base na última atualização.

  • Total comments (Total de comentários): Ordena as issues pelo número total de comentários.

  • Best match (Melhor correspondência): Exibe as issues mais relevantes para a sua busca.

  • Reactions (Reações): Ordena as issues com base nas reações que receberam.

Além disso, você pode escolher entre Newest (Mais recentes) ou Oldest (Mais antigas) para definir a direção da ordenação.

Lista de Issues

Aqui é onde estão disponíveis todas as issues do repositório. A lista de issues exibirá os resultados conforme os filtros aplicados, a ordenação selecionada e os termos digitados na barra de busca. Cada issue aparece como um cartão contendo:.

  • Caixa de seleção para ações em lote;

  • O título da issue (que resume o problema ou sugestão);

  • O número da issue (um identificador único);

  • Quem abriu a issue e quando;

  • O número de comentários que a issue recebeu;

  • Labels (se aplicáveis), para facilitar a identificação da categoria.

Representação de uma issue na lista de issues

Clique em uma issue para acessar diretamente a página dessa issue.


A aba Issues no GitHub é essencial para acompanhar e discutir tarefas dentro de um projeto. Por enquanto, focamos apenas no básico para você começar. Conforme for ganhando experiência, você pode explorar outras funções mais avançadas, como projetos e milestones.

Atualizado

Isto foi útil?